- What is Matthews International's industrial technologies — D&A?
- Matthews International (MATW) reported industrial technologies — D&A of $2.97M in Q1 2026.
- How has Matthews International's industrial technologies — D&A changed year-over-year?
- Matthews International's industrial technologies — D&A decreased by 47.4% year-over-year, from $5.64M to $2.97M.
- What is the long-term trend for Matthews International's industrial technologies — D&A?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Matthews International's industrial technologies — D&A has grown at a 17.6%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$11.43M to $21.87M.
- What does industrial technologies — D&A mean?
- Reflects the systematic allocation of the cost of tangible and intangible assets over their useful lives within the Industrial Technologies segment. This non-cash expense highlights the capital intensity of the segment's manufacturing and automation infrastructure.
